Ticket: Staging env misconfigured for Siftgate bloom filter

The bloom layer in front of the Pellet KV store is rejecting all lookups in staging because the env file was copied from the dev template without credentials. False-positive tuning values are fine; only the auth line is missing. To unblock the weekly demo, the Pellet admission secret must be set on the following line.

env line for yaguf-fajop: LEDGER_TOKEN13=fb08984397349

The Tollgate payments service has a small set of integration tests marked `@unstable` because they depend on the simulated settlement clock, which can drift under load. Please do not disable these tests; instead, rerun them with the `--frozen-clock` flag, which pins the simulator and removes the flakiness in nearly every case. Running the simulator locally requires authenticating to the internal clock service with the key below.

API key for kahop-bagef: zpat2_yb

## Deploy Step 4: Warm the Autocomplete Index

Welcome aboard! The Murmuret autocomplete index is famously sluggish on cold starts — first queries can take 8+ seconds. So before flipping traffic, run `murmuret warm --full` and grab a coffee; it takes about ten minutes. The warmer talks to the suggestion store directly, so your env file needs the store's access secret. Add your port and host settings first, then put the secret on the next line.

vault entry, fahog-yadug: LEDGER_TOKEN29=06d5198011911d1ceff8ec041f463